Linux 系统与网络连接194
Linux 操作系统以其出色的网络连接功能而闻名,它支持广泛的网络协议和配置选项,使您可以轻松地连接到 Internet、局域网和其他网络。本文将深入探讨 Linux 系统中的网络连接,包括网络配置、网络工具和故障排除技巧。
网络接口配置
在 Linux 中,每个网络接口都由一个网络接口控制器 (NIC) 表示,可以是物理网卡或虚拟网卡。要配置网络接口,需要修改 "/etc/network/interfaces" 文件。对于以太网接口,典型的配置如下:```
auto eth0
iface eth0 inet dhcp
```
以上配置将启用以太网接口 "eth0" 并使用 DHCP 自动获取 IP 地址。对于静态 IP 地址,可以使用以下配置:```
auto eth0
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
gateway 192.168.1.1
```
网络工具
Linux 提供了广泛的网络工具,用于诊断和管理网络连接。一些常用工具包括:* ifconfig:显示网络接口信息,例如 IP 地址、MAC 地址和网络配置。
* route:显示路由表和管理路由。
* netstat:显示有关网络连接、端口和协议的信息。
* tcpdump:捕获并分析网络流量。
* nslookup:查找域名系统 (DNS) 记录。
故障排除技巧
在 Linux 系统中解决网络连接问题时,以下技巧可能有用:* 检查物理连接:确保网络电缆已正确连接到网络接口卡和路由器或交换机。
* 检查网络配置:使用 "ifconfig" 和 "route" 命令验证网络接口和路由表配置是否正确。
* 使用网络工具:使用 "netstat" 和 "tcpdump" 等工具诊断网络连接问题,例如丢包、延迟或错误。
* 更新固件:确保网络接口卡和路由器或交换机已更新到最新固件。
* 联系 ISP:如果以上步骤未解决问题,请联系您的互联网服务提供商 (ISP),以排除是否为外部网络问题。
高级网络配置
对于需要更高级网络配置的用户,Linux 提供了以下选项:* 网络地址转换 (NAT):允许多个计算机使用单个公共 IP 地址连接到 Internet。
* 防火墙:控制和过滤传入和传出网络流量,以增强系统安全性。
* 虚拟专用网络 (VPN):创建加密隧道,允许安全地连接到远程网络。
* 路由和转发:配置 Linux 系统作为路由器或网关,以便将多个网络连接在一起。
Linux 系统提供了一套全面的网络连接选项和工具,使您可以轻松地连接到 Internet、局域网和其他网络。通过了解网络接口配置、网络工具和故障排除技巧,您可以有效地管理和诊断 Linux 系统中的网络连接问题。对于需要更高级配置的用户,Linux 还支持 NAT、防火墙、VPN 和路由等功能。
2024-11-04
新文章

iOS系统文件更改:安全风险、管理方法及开发者应对策略

华为鸿蒙HarmonyOS 135个补丁深度解析:安全增强、性能优化与系统稳定性

Android系统日历事件添加:底层机制与应用开发详解

彻底掌控Windows更新:禁用、延迟及风险规避指南

Windows、macOS系统迁移与数据安全:完整指南

Linux系统基础:内核、Shell与常用命令详解

华为鸿蒙HarmonyOS车载系统深度解析:技术架构、优势与挑战

鸿蒙OS技术深度解析:架构、特性及未来展望

Android 系统主界面修改:深度解读与实现方法

Android系统全球市场份额及影响因素深度解析
热门文章

iOS 系统的局限性

Mac OS 9:革命性操作系统的深度剖析

macOS 直接安装新系统,保留原有数据

Linux USB 设备文件系统

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

iOS 操作系统:移动领域的先驱

华为鸿蒙系统:全面赋能多场景智慧体验
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]
